OpenMS
|
Pimped QListView for Layers of a Canvas. More...
#include <OpenMS/VISUAL/LayerListView.h>
Signals | |
void | layerDataChanged () |
emitted whenever a change to a layer happened, e.g. its name was changed, it was removed, or a new layer was selected More... | |
Public Member Functions | |
LayerListView (QWidget *parent) | |
Default constructor. More... | |
void | update (PlotWidget *active_widget) |
rebuild list of layers and remember current widget (for context menu etc) More... | |
Private Member Functions | |
void | currentRowChangedAction_ (int i) |
active row was changed by user to new row i More... | |
void | itemChangedAction_ (QListWidgetItem *item) |
void | contextMenuEvent (QContextMenuEvent *event) override |
void | itemDoubleClickedAction_ (QListWidgetItem *) |
show preferences dialog More... | |
Private Attributes | |
PlotWidget * | spectrum_widget_ = nullptr |
holds the actual data. Might be nullptr. More... | |
Pimped QListView for Layers of a Canvas.
LayerListView | ( | QWidget * | parent | ) |
Default constructor.
|
overrideprivate |
|
private |
active row was changed by user to new row i
|
private |
|
private |
show preferences dialog
|
signal |
emitted whenever a change to a layer happened, e.g. its name was changed, it was removed, or a new layer was selected
Referenced by TOPPViewBase::TOPPViewBase().
void update | ( | PlotWidget * | active_widget | ) |
rebuild list of layers and remember current widget (for context menu etc)
Referenced by TOPPViewBase::updateLayerBar().
|
private |
holds the actual data. Might be nullptr.